The average human resources manager gross salary in Budapest, Hungary is 15 347 283 Ft or an equivalent hourly rate of 7 379 Ft. This is 4% higher (+589 345 Ft) than the average human resources manager salary in Hungary. In addition, they earn an average bonus of 1 215 505 Ft. Salary estimates based on salary survey data collected directly from employers and anonymous employees in Budapest, Hungary. An entry level human resources manager (1-3 years of experience) earns an average salary of 10 709 567 Ft. On the other end, a senior level human resources manager (8+ years of experience) earns an average salary of 19 105 242 Ft.
